Size: a a a

2019 November 05

V

Valentin in Frontend_ru
Поч не заводится.  Ну уже на след выходных прочекаю
источник

AK

Alexander Kladkov in Frontend_ru
Valentin
Поч не заводится.  Ну уже на след выходных прочекаю
Ну. Я хз что там могло пойти не так
источник

AK

Alexander Kladkov in Frontend_ru
Там одна команда)
источник

V

Valentin in Frontend_ru
Alexander Kladkov
Ну. Я хз что там могло пойти не так
Даже пару тем есть на лерне по этому поводу. У меня всегда все заводится только когда доскональности изучу либу. Либо я тупой, либо проклят
источник

V

Valentin in Frontend_ru
Была одна преподавательница, которая хотела выкинуть меня из ИТ
источник

NV

Nick Volkov in Frontend_ru
Alexander Kladkov
> монорепозиторий какой профит дает
Шаринг констант. Общие модели между БД. Простой пример. На фронте и бэк юзаются регулярки и правила для валидации пароля. В одном месте поменял всё заработало. Я сейчас в моно-репе делаю веб и реакт нейтив часть. Общие компоненты и бизнес логика шарится между вебом и нейтивом. В итоге пишу один раз код и всё работает одинакого на разных платформах. Ну с константами надеюсь не надо обёяснять почему это удобно
Ну на эти задачи в мире мультирепозиториев тоже есть свои решения. Конфиги, которые тянутся по апи. Не берусь судить, что одно другого лучше/хуже
источник

AK

Alexander Kladkov in Frontend_ru
Nick Volkov
Ну на эти задачи в мире мультирепозиториев тоже есть свои решения. Конфиги, которые тянутся по апи. Не берусь судить, что одно другого лучше/хуже
Ну да. Конфиги это конечно не новое, но хранить регулярки в конфиге хз)
источник

AK

Alexander Kladkov in Frontend_ru
Тем более константы)
источник

NV

Nick Volkov in Frontend_ru
Alexander Kladkov
Тем более константы)
А шо такого? Их и придумали, чтобы хранить весь этот стаф в них
источник

AK

Alexander Kladkov in Frontend_ru
Nick Volkov
А шо такого? Их и придумали, чтобы хранить весь этот стаф в них
Ну даж хз. Я бы не засовывал такое в конфиги
источник

AK

Alexander Kladkov in Frontend_ru
Так же в монорепе удобно шарить между проектами либу компонентов
источник

AK

Alexander Kladkov in Frontend_ru
При этом будет версионность, и ничего не отломается
источник

NV

Nick Volkov in Frontend_ru
Alexander Kladkov
При этом будет версионность, и ничего не отломается
Ну у нас юикит просто в отдельной репе
источник

V

Valentin in Frontend_ru
Alexander Kladkov
Так же в монорепе удобно шарить между проектами либу компонентов
Вот это здесь удачно зашло. Кстати наверное это отличное решение для каких то приложение для компании с внутренним и внешним интерфейсом. Особенно если пара разных продуктов, или внешняя разделена ещё на несколько оч разных продуктов
источник

AK

Alexander Kladkov in Frontend_ru
Nick Volkov
Ну у нас юикит просто в отдельной репе
Ну так это по сути тоже самое :)
источник

AK

Alexander Kladkov in Frontend_ru
Просто другая организация немного с своими плюсами и минусами
источник

AK

Alexander Kladkov in Frontend_ru
Но на мой взгляд плюсов больше
источник

NV

Nick Volkov in Frontend_ru
Alexander Kladkov
Но на мой взгляд плюсов больше
Смотри, ты вот перечисляешь плюсы, мне сложно понять почему они плюсы, когда существуют решения этих проблем в мире мультиреп. А вот что касается минусов - это, в первую очередь, наверное, сильно распухший гит.
Но куча корпораций используют такой подход, значит, наверное, я действительно не понимаю чего то.
источник

AK

Alexander Kladkov in Frontend_ru
Nick Volkov
Смотри, ты вот перечисляешь плюсы, мне сложно понять почему они плюсы, когда существуют решения этих проблем в мире мультиреп. А вот что касается минусов - это, в первую очередь, наверное, сильно распухший гит.
Но куча корпораций используют такой подход, значит, наверное, я действительно не понимаю чего то.
Так же ускорение сборки (за счет переиспользованися node_modules). Контроль зависимостей (если версии отличаются в приложении, то lerna тебе подскажет, что у репах разные версии используются
источник

AK

Alexander Kladkov in Frontend_ru
Одинаковые ассеты тоже хранить в конфигах? :)
источник